Workshop Assessment: Finding the Right Workshop for You
If you ask the right questions, you can often find out more about a workshop than a website or brochure will tell you. For example:
size of the typical class?
qualifications of the instructors?
the type of project you will be working on ?
(size? species of wood? style?)
tools you will be required to bring?
tools provided by the school; will hand tools or power tools be used?
if is a raising part of the class?
the amount of hands-on versus classroom time?
the hours the class will run; are there evening classes?
lodging and meal arrangements?
travel and location details?
workshop facilities?
